Version bump. Uses SLOT=2.2. Works with asm-2.2.
authorJoshua Nichols <nichoj@gentoo.org>
Mon, 15 Jan 2007 00:55:21 +0000 (00:55 +0000)
committerJoshua Nichols <nichoj@gentoo.org>
Mon, 15 Jan 2007 00:55:21 +0000 (00:55 +0000)
Package-Manager: portage-2.1.2_rc4-r4

dev-java/cglib/ChangeLog
dev-java/cglib/Manifest
dev-java/cglib/cglib-2.2_beta1.ebuild [new file with mode: 0644]
dev-java/cglib/files/digest-cglib-2.2_beta1 [new file with mode: 0644]

index 749a3cc59ff584091db7050cde14e77144875520..2471f3a504dd694034b060a73e5c18ada55b10bb 100644 (file)
@@ -1,6 +1,11 @@
 # ChangeLog for dev-java/cglib
-#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/cglib/ChangeLog,v 1.17 2006/09/09 07:41:11 betelgeuse Exp $
+#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/cglib/ChangeLog,v 1.18 2007/01/15 00:55:21 nichoj Exp $
+
+*cglib-2.2_beta1 (15 Jan 2007)
+
+  15 Jan 2007; Joshua Nichols <nichoj@gentoo.org> +cglib-2.2_beta1.ebuild:
+  Version bump. Uses SLOT=2.2. Works with asm-2.2.
 
   09 Sep 2006; Petteri Räty <betelgeuse@gentoo.org> -cglib-2.0.2.ebuild:
   Removed an old version.
index 01b512a2e0259026faf245b41691a5aaf53f6cc5..ed135b1de309d710dd4bee2813233083c3039bd5 100644 (file)
@@ -1,6 +1,3 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
 AUX cglib-2.0.2-asm-1.4.3.patch 721 RMD160 3fe4b4b08f5a02efc1acbc43924fcc2c4dbf075c SHA1 c70c0ee78da474d92087aef4ff8d3287423aa724 SHA256 06997a5c61860cc5426ad0f7783447fd4f980692c21a321c533d54d87281f73a
 MD5 a7a4f8f597ccfc2d44762869fa7e983f files/cglib-2.0.2-asm-1.4.3.patch 721
 RMD160 3fe4b4b08f5a02efc1acbc43924fcc2c4dbf075c files/cglib-2.0.2-asm-1.4.3.patch 721
@@ -8,6 +5,7 @@ SHA256 06997a5c61860cc5426ad0f7783447fd4f980692c21a321c533d54d87281f73a files/cg
 DIST cglib-src-2.0.2.jar 445834 RMD160 7f0e63ee69c090465db906288b87ff541fd00691 SHA1 414985d703e1adc433bea5188e10015d40450423 SHA256 91644a03487a9a0161a54e0c3644c34c44e507557dcf4b8b97a60dd91e67cd1c
 DIST cglib-src-2.1_2.jar 1610212 RMD160 dcce34c6c3640746f1f492ec2cede324c1e796a5 SHA1 d95cb04eb23276d38263a26135817565ebf75461 SHA256 80e0278f97a41dd2258a2020b5f38bee1dabe4370931837f8ac5100dcf650ea9
 DIST cglib-src-2.1_3.jar 1610524 RMD160 9341441cb931f8494c5a0917db1b526ae06a6511 SHA1 9f1bb4dcdd99bacc166a917a3fa6489ba54c3c38 SHA256 652c7533f5c6d4bf66ba13871f70133e9ffdca648e49354cff7f39824282739e
+DIST cglib-src-2.2_beta1.jar 1502672 RMD160 f1498df604115cdb7f50932c094c3bd3bb689f67 SHA1 03ee5d15379b0f71753527c45e68fcfceee2eb72 SHA256 6722247e1cdd4c63f80245b488f22054e72c211c42ea33c7e7e88491c8455b21
 EBUILD cglib-2.0.2-r1.ebuild 1412 RMD160 eb2b83b6cc6eec4014692eb6d5dfdbbca1f249cd SHA1 03d032dd5451c18101f0c5a8038d22896744371d SHA256 7b495f8990778d69eb6291543fbba5ab38df4142439d9f1c16daf6bb501bc953
 MD5 146d70c2f507c8f9999abc54d01b5374 cglib-2.0.2-r1.ebuild 1412
 RMD160 eb2b83b6cc6eec4014692eb6d5dfdbbca1f249cd cglib-2.0.2-r1.ebuild 1412
@@ -24,10 +22,14 @@ EBUILD cglib-2.1.3.ebuild 1283 RMD160 f974dea6bd6df94820e2cc0d25807ebdacd96af8 S
 MD5 2038f9d5ae1a41d76d60dfb207ba1efc cglib-2.1.3.ebuild 1283
 RMD160 f974dea6bd6df94820e2cc0d25807ebdacd96af8 cglib-2.1.3.ebuild 1283
 SHA256 a1a9262f3f26016cbac2519b18d024bfcf9bc971e6fff3b24e573dbdfa3e1117 cglib-2.1.3.ebuild 1283
-MISC ChangeLog 2628 RMD160 42eec6099bb51e53a9c34774778220d07d247f4f SHA1 317562c2f1892f28cf739e4e73998a8d138080fa SHA256 e99c74e6871d07fe44bd406c4933645e0f89cc0454990df0ce5ff533ee1dfde7
-MD5 12b9a098e2e9574a5e024585c4a9b38d ChangeLog 2628
-RMD160 42eec6099bb51e53a9c34774778220d07d247f4f ChangeLog 2628
-SHA256 e99c74e6871d07fe44bd406c4933645e0f89cc0454990df0ce5ff533ee1dfde7 ChangeLog 2628
+EBUILD cglib-2.2_beta1.ebuild 1265 RMD160 f2de240efe1afa4358c2a41fccab37fc6f4f8675 SHA1 7773b1e3efd51d8a1e1383f912320d9faf78152c SHA256 1296081417d2715c35c5001c9a642bc4045e43ed168f08540fcd98e6f915af9f
+MD5 4fde0ef84e81cf1299eccb16ad350198 cglib-2.2_beta1.ebuild 1265
+RMD160 f2de240efe1afa4358c2a41fccab37fc6f4f8675 cglib-2.2_beta1.ebuild 1265
+SHA256 1296081417d2715c35c5001c9a642bc4045e43ed168f08540fcd98e6f915af9f cglib-2.2_beta1.ebuild 1265
+MISC ChangeLog 2783 RMD160 462df8046ae9e229ddf9401035a2d760979fe66c SHA1 12dc63cbf07e79f31f34adb6a0940610c59e4f0a SHA256 bc5f171ddc3ec5eb592a08feee86fb6ef055ec4417ea736572e79d3620c1ba7e
+MD5 179dedea0cc65e2cfb49ffb7f58e1d9a ChangeLog 2783
+RMD160 462df8046ae9e229ddf9401035a2d760979fe66c ChangeLog 2783
+SHA256 bc5f171ddc3ec5eb592a08feee86fb6ef055ec4417ea736572e79d3620c1ba7e ChangeLog 2783
 MISC metadata.xml 157 RMD160 ab0b3741457dee7531f59c4da0f0e9e8399af084 SHA1 c37a6b9922aef61b5b3387655bccb6e3b16e0e26 SHA256 295d02c5805b0257938eb80314b371daac94b8d6ea85629a902de7a824adc0c9
 MD5 a6ec7d7724fbd068ffb39b5be56134ed metadata.xml 157
 RMD160 ab0b3741457dee7531f59c4da0f0e9e8399af084 metadata.xml 157
@@ -44,10 +46,6 @@ SHA256 ffbe52f20cdf3beeffed13dffccfe61e5e6befda4c733859222f1515d22a1f8a files/di
 MD5 14b76cafd9790d7579958a0b94bfb8f5 files/digest-cglib-2.1.3 241
 RMD160 da06df039c394aa247356789104a68e1ba710c09 files/digest-cglib-2.1.3 241
 SHA256 8c24fe43f41735b7ca3fa2f34b50797a27437e6cc357340d1ff9b1382a39d7ab files/digest-cglib-2.1.3 241
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.5 (GNU/Linux)
-
-iD8DBQFFAnAhcxLzpIGCsLQRArljAJ4/fbLyyAIYAoucBxN7f5/CLyXraACcCn2N
-TvVIVYghSGo1Mk7LAjX1ef8=
-=EHkg
------END PGP SIGNATURE-----
+MD5 ba1c2c1ed75083220e51d333a34ee919 files/digest-cglib-2.2_beta1 253
+RMD160 189f3d4dd3791c5f259a66bf80e60cda44bfe392 files/digest-cglib-2.2_beta1 253
+SHA256 b242e175268370d139ced7f9fa9aa10e53a672eae7899b45a5e5b266f4285992 files/digest-cglib-2.2_beta1 253
diff --git a/dev-java/cglib/cglib-2.2_beta1.ebuild b/dev-java/cglib/cglib-2.2_beta1.ebuild
new file mode 100644 (file)
index 0000000..f7e95b0
--- /dev/null
@@ -0,0 +1,43 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/cglib/cglib-2.2_beta1.ebuild,v 1.1 2007/01/15 00:55:21 nichoj Exp $
+
+inherit eutils java-pkg-2 java-ant-2
+
+DESCRIPTION="cglib is a powerful, high performance and quality Code Generation Library, It is used to extend JAVA classes and implements interfaces at runtime."
+SRC_URI="mirror://sourceforge/${PN}/${PN}-src-${PV}.jar"
+HOMEPAGE="http://cglib.sourceforge.net"
+LICENSE="Apache-1.1"
+SLOT="2.2"
+KEYWORDS="~x86 ~amd64"
+COMMON_DEP="=dev-java/asm-2.2*"
+RDEPEND=">=virtual/jre-1.4
+       ${COMMON_DEP}"
+DEPEND=">=virtual/jdk-1.4
+       source? ( app-arch/zip )
+       >=dev-java/ant-core-1.5
+       dev-java/jarjar
+       ${COMMON_DEP}"
+IUSE="doc source"
+
+S=${WORKDIR}
+
+src_unpack() {
+       jar xf ${DISTDIR}/${A} || die "failed to unpack"
+
+       cd ${S}/lib
+       rm -f *.jar
+       java-pkg_jar-from asm-2.2 asm.jar
+       java-pkg_jar-from asm-2.2 asm-util.jar
+       java-pkg_jar-from asm-2.2 asm-commons.jar
+       java-pkg_jar-from ant-core ant.jar
+       java-pkg_jar-from --build-only jarjar-1
+}
+
+src_install() {
+       java-pkg_newjar dist/${PN}-${PV}.jar ${PN}.jar
+       java-pkg_newjar dist/${PN}-nodep-${PV}.jar ${PN}-nodep.jar
+
+       dodoc NOTICE README
+       use doc && java-pkg_dohtml -r docs/*
+}
diff --git a/dev-java/cglib/files/digest-cglib-2.2_beta1 b/dev-java/cglib/files/digest-cglib-2.2_beta1
new file mode 100644 (file)
index 0000000..44a3f35
--- /dev/null
@@ -0,0 +1,3 @@
+MD5 9f4d0b03115f92aa4bb06b840c19b542 cglib-src-2.2_beta1.jar 1502672
+RMD160 f1498df604115cdb7f50932c094c3bd3bb689f67 cglib-src-2.2_beta1.jar 1502672
+SHA256 6722247e1cdd4c63f80245b488f22054e72c211c42ea33c7e7e88491c8455b21 cglib-src-2.2_beta1.jar 1502672